Hebbail - Kumta, Uttara Kannada

Hebbail is a village situated in the Kumta taluka of Uttara Kannada district, Karnataka. It is located approximately 20 km from the tehsil headquarters in Kumta and around 76 km from the district headquarters in Karwar. Alakod serves as the Gram Panchayat for Hebbail village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Hebbail is 603480. The village covers a total geographical area of 1496.94 hectares and falls under the 581362 pincode. Kumta is the nearest town, located about 20 km away.

Hebbail village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Kumta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Uttara Kannada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Hebbail

As per Census 2011, Hebbail village has a total population of 653 people, consisting of 342 males and 311 females. The village has 156 households and a sex ratio of 909 females per 1,000 males. There are 67 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 536 literate and 117 illiterate residents.

Transport and Connectivity of Hebbail

Public transport in the Hebbail is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Kumta, while the nearest airport is Hubli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 86.4 km.
